mongdb和redis区别 mongodb和redis的场景

本文目录一览:

  • 1、谈谈redis,memcache,mongodb的区别和具体应用场景
  • 2、redis和mongodb哪个简单
  • 3、请问个人使用,哪种数据库比较好?
  • 4、mongodb和redis区别是什么?
谈谈redis,memcache,mongodb的区别和具体应用场景1、Redis只能使用单线程,性能受限于CPU性能,故单实例CPU最高才可能达到5-6wQPS每秒(取决于数据结构 , 数据大小以及服务器硬件性能 , 日常环境中QPS高峰大约在1-2w左右) 。
2、Redis跟memcache不同的是,储存在Redis中的数据是持久化的,断电或重启后 , 数据也不会丢失 。
3、常见的nosql数据库有Redis、Memcache、MongoDb 。
4、MongoDB和Redis的区别是什么内存管理机制Redis 数据全部存在内存 , 定期写入磁盘 , 当内存不够时,可以选择指定的 LRU 算法删除数据 。
5、事务性系统适用场景:Redis 最佳应用场景:适用于数据变化快且数据库大小可遇见(适合内存容量)的应用程序 。
redis和mongodb哪个简单1、mongodb更吃内存,因为当mongo发现内存不够的时候,是以2的指数级别来申请内存的 。所以一般都建议把mongodb单独放 。其实可以说redis更像缓存机制,cookie,也可以设定数据的过期时间,当然也可以永久存储(但是好像稍逊色?) 。
【mongdb和redis区别 mongodb和redis的场景】2、Mogodb简介:mogodb是一种文档性的数据库 。先解释一下文档的数据库,即可以存放xml、json、bson类型系那个的数据 。这些数据具备自述性(self-describing),呈现分层的树状数据结构 。redis可以用hash存放简单关系型数据 。
3、性能 都比较高,性能对我们来说应该都不是瓶颈 。总体来讲 , TPS 方面 redis 和 memcache 差不多,要大于 mongodb 。操作的便利性 memcache 数据结构单一 。
4、mongodb实现语言是 C++,协议是BSON、自定义二进制 而redis实现语言是 C/C++,协议是类Telnet 。
请问个人使用,哪种数据库比较好?TiDB TiDB是一款基于MySQL的分布式数据库,拥有高可用性、高性能和高安全性 , 是国内最受欢迎的数据库之一 。
MySQLMySQL是最受欢迎的开源SQL数据库管理系统,它由 MySQL AB开发、发布和支持 。MySQL AB是一家基于MySQL开发人员的商业公司,它是一家使用了一种成功的商业模式来结合开源价值和方法论的第二代开源公司 。
因为,毕竟,这些都只是一种透视得方式 。从数据库导出的数据就是从另一端导入的数据 。这里我们并不讨论其他的数据库各种各样的导出数据的方法,您将学会如何用MySQL来实现数据导出 。
数据量较大 , 比如千万级,用postgresql , 它号称对标Oracle , 处理千万级数据还是可以的,也是易学易用 。数据量一般,比如百万级,用mysql , 这个级别的数据量mysql处理还是比较快的 。
MyISAM 数据库与磁盘非常地兼容而不占用过多的CPU和内存 。MySQL可以运行于Windows系统而不会发生冲突,在UNIX或类似UNIX系统上运行则更好 。你还可以通过使用64位处理器来获取额外的一些性能 。
现在最好用的就是cache数据库了,它有这些特点:速度快 。Caché数据库在同等条件下查询相同数据比Oracle等普通数据库要快 。
mongodb和redis区别是什么?MongoDB和Redis都是NoSQL,采用结构型数据存储 。二者在使用场景中,存在一定的区别,这也主要由于二者在内存映射的处理过程,持久化的处理方法不同 。
redis 丰富一些 , 数据操作方面,redis 更好一些,较少的网络 IO 次数,同时还提供 list,set,hash 等数据结构的存储 。mongodb 支持丰富的数据表达,索引 , 最类似关系型数据库,支持的查询语言非常丰富 。
redis支持的数据类型更丰富,而MongoDB数据结构比较单一,但是支持丰富的数据表达,索引 。MongoDB的集群支持比较成熟 。所以,在一般使用情况下,mongodb可以当作简单场景下的但是性能高数倍的MySQL,Redis基本只会用来做缓存 。
MongoDB[1] 是一个基于分布式文件存储的数据库 。由C++语言编写 。旨在为WEB应用提供可扩展的高性能数据存储解决方案 。
mongodb和memcached不是一个范畴内的东西 。mongodb是文档型的非关系型数据库 , 其优势在于查询功能比较强大,能存储海量数据 。mongodb和memcached不存在谁替换谁的问题 。和memcached更为接近的是redis 。

    推荐阅读